Recipe: Watermelon strawberry popsicles
I like to experiment with popsicle flavors in the summer time. With so much fruit in season right now, it's so easy to make a healthy treat.

In fact, I've been known to let my girls eat homemade popsicles for breakfast, including these.
1 tablespoon lime or lemon juice (It's better with lime, but I seem to have lemons on hand more than limes).
Pour all of the ingredients into a blender and puree the mixture. Pour into popsicle molds. Let freeze for several hours until they are frozen, though, they're pretty good as a slushie, too.
This recipe would make about a dozen small popsicles.
